> The blob_encap and blob_decap functions were not flushing the dcache
> before passing data to CAAM/DMA and not invalidating the dcache when
> getting data back.
> Therefore, blob encapsulation and decapsulation failed with errors like
> the following due to data cache incoherency:
> "40000006: DECO: desc idx 0: Invalid KEY command"
>
> To ensure coherency, we allocate aligned memory to store the data passed
> to/from CAAM and flush/invalidate the memory regions.
> Blobs can now be encapsulated and decapsulated with the blob cmd as well
> as from board code by calling blob_encap and blob_decap directly.
>
> Tested on an i.MX6Q board.
